Other than that and finishing my latest book which was loosely based on the Steven Truscott story. The book was called The Way the Crow Flies by a Toronto writer, Ann-Marie MacDonald. I had read the original book The Steven Truscott Story some years ago and remember when this happened. I can recall even as a child wondering how on earth this 14 year old boy could be convicted solely on circumstantial evidence. He was tried in an adult court and sentenced to hang for the rape and murder of a 12 year old friend, Lynne Harper. Amazingly enough, just last week he was finally acquitted of the crime some 48 years later. He only served 10 years in prison and then was paroled and given a new name however it took all this time for him to be acquitted.
